On July 15, 1915, about 1 year after Mary Faulkner "Mamie" Brown Locke died, Kemp put both, Fannie Virginia and Ernest Lynwood Locke into foster care at the Children's Home Society (C.H.S.) in Richmond, VA. ). Fannie was 14 yrs. old and Ernest was 2 1/2 yrs. old when this occurred. Fannie went out into 2 foster home situations, that didn't work out. Papers related to her placement noted that she was "unmanageable". After the second return back to C.H.S., she stayed there helping to tend to the younger children.

When Fannie got older she went to night school to learn to read and write and that is where she meant her husband James. She married James in 1926. She and James were deeply in love and these were the happiest times in her life. (Note: on her marriage certicicate she listed Morris and Annie Clarke as her parents). James died in 1945 of spinal meningitis, at Grace Hospital, Richmond, Virginia. Four years later, Fannie married Claude - this was the second marriage for both.

James arrived to America by ship from London, England where he and his family settled in Ocean View, Virginia (close to Virginia Beach, as known today). He worked at amusement park in Ocean View until he and his family earned enough money to buy property. They bought property at the beach and turned it in to rooms for rent. He then moved to Richmond, Virginia to attend night school to learn to read, write and improve his English. 

It was during this time that James met Fannie Virginia Locke. He was working as a streetcar conductor in Richmond (this is the occupation he listed on his marriage certificate in 1926). He and the family in Ocean View went on to have the Estelle family cottages built on property and they become successful rental properties. (Pictures to validate Estelle Cottages and property are available in records maintained at the Ocean View, Virginia court house). When James applied for his social security card in 1936, he was working for Virginia Electric and Power Company. James died in 1945 at the age of 58 of spinal meningitis, at Grace Hospital, Richmond, Virginia.

On July, 15, 1915, Ernest (along with his sister Fannie) was placed in the foster care at (Children's Home Society (C.H.S.) 1 year after his mother died in 1914. Ernest was 2 1/2 years old at the time. Ernest and Fannie were placed in sepearate homes. However, Fannie's 1st placement did not work out and she was brought back to the CHS at which time she was placed with her brother. Ernest stayed in this foster home. His foster parents had high expectations and were "well-to-do". Their naural children were well educated. However, Ernest had never attended school before his placement and had little regard for education. He failed third grade. When his guardian died, Ernest ran away. Authorities in Roanoke put Ernest into Juvenile Detention and placed him in a boarding home in Roanoke. This placement did not work out well for Ernest either. However, by then, his sister had married James Henry Waters and Ernest went to live with them in 1925-1926 in Richmond, VA. When the social worker finally went to visit Ernest in 1932, Ernest had already had moved out (he was 20 years old by then) and was living in Manteo, VA. With the help of his friends, he moved into a house with the Ransom family. His father told the social worker that Ernest was very happy there and well adjusted in his new home.
